Click or drag to resize
FormExtensionsFormField Method
Returns HTML markup for given formComponent. The markup contains a label and an editing element representing the form component given.

Namespace: Kentico.Forms.Web.Mvc
Assembly: Kentico.Content.Web.Mvc (in Kentico.Content.Web.Mvc.dll) Version: 13.0.131
Syntax
C#
public static IHtmlContentProxy FormField(
	this HtmlHelperExtensionPoint htmlHelper,
	FormComponent formComponent,
	FormFieldRenderingConfiguration renderingConfiguration = null
)

Parameters

htmlHelper
Type: Kentico.Web.MvcHtmlHelperExtensionPoint
HtmlHelper extension.
formComponent
Type: Kentico.Forms.Web.MvcFormComponent
The form component to render the markup for.
renderingConfiguration (Optional)
Type: Kentico.Forms.Web.MvcFormFieldRenderingConfiguration
Configuration for the form field rendering. If null, Default is used.

Return Value

Type: IHtmlContentProxy
HTML markup for form component.

Usage Note

In Visual Basic and C#, you can call this method as an instance method on any object of type HtmlHelperExtensionPoint. When you use instance method syntax to call this method, omit the first parameter. For more information, see Extension Methods (Visual Basic) or Extension Methods (C# Programming Guide).
Exceptions
ExceptionCondition
ArgumentNullExceptionThrown when htmlHelper or formComponent is null.
See Also